UK-based oil explorer Tullow Oil and U.S. producer Anadarko Petroleum made new discoveries around their Jubilee field in Ghana, Tullow said on Thursday.
Tullow Oil said its Mahogany-3 well had made a new discovery beneath its Jubilee field and that the drilling also showed the field extended far further to the southeast than it thought.
The company said in a statement on Thursday that the results raised its expectations for the field, although it did not specify new reserves estimates.
